From 0536ffc1a837c1b9ebbeebef3e53fd76914f9791 Mon Sep 17 00:00:00 2001 From: Reinout Meliesie Date: Sun, 2 Mar 2025 19:52:08 +0100 Subject: [PATCH] Disable unused phases & fix formatting --- python3.11-bw-file-resubmit.nix | 4 ++++ python3.11-django-imagekit.nix | 12 ++++++++---- python3.11-django-pgtrigger.nix | 10 ++++++---- python3.11-django-sass-processor.nix | 12 ++++++++---- 4 files changed, 26 insertions(+), 12 deletions(-) diff --git a/python3.11-bw-file-resubmit.nix b/python3.11-bw-file-resubmit.nix index 1c6617d..028708a 100644 --- a/python3.11-bw-file-resubmit.nix +++ b/python3.11-bw-file-resubmit.nix @@ -16,6 +16,10 @@ mkDerivation { hash = "sha256-RT3fF2oMsf0klUwMBJ02Dgdt2rsoB7A3SjiuyVuYU7A=" ; } ; + dontPatch = true ; + dontConfigure = true ; + dontBuild = true ; + installPhase = '' runHook preInstall diff --git a/python3.11-django-imagekit.nix b/python3.11-django-imagekit.nix index d88675f..7724a42 100644 --- a/python3.11-django-imagekit.nix +++ b/python3.11-django-imagekit.nix @@ -8,20 +8,24 @@ with stdenv ; mkDerivation { pname = "python-django-imagekit" ; version = "2024-07-22-4cbbc52" ; - + src = fetchFromGitHub { owner = "matthewwithanm" ; repo = "django-imagekit" ; rev = "4cbbc52fabfd99a6306cdbb8ab2602bb0a0190a9" ; hash = "sha256-QYWhXh404JNAZN7kXYhsPQpFpyBA/MehxJOxdDKX0Mc=" ; } ; - + + dontPatch = true ; + dontConfigure = true ; + dontBuild = true + installPhase = '' runHook preInstall - + mkdir -p $out/lib/python3.11/site-packages cp -r $src/imagekit $out/lib/python3.11/site-packages/ - + runHook postInstall '' ; } diff --git a/python3.11-django-pgtrigger.nix b/python3.11-django-pgtrigger.nix index ff98a51..d007da8 100644 --- a/python3.11-django-pgtrigger.nix +++ b/python3.11-django-pgtrigger.nix @@ -8,7 +8,7 @@ with stdenv ; mkDerivation { pname = "python-django-pgtrigger" ; version = "2024-12-24-fa2155e" ; - + src = fetchFromGitHub { owner = "ambitioneng" ; repo = "django-pgtrigger" ; @@ -16,14 +16,16 @@ mkDerivation { hash = "sha256-K+JjAermtSiVUnPbtyabpQN2ghnRIkwt329Ytp8zeQk=" ; } ; + dontPatch = true ; + dontConfigure = true ; dontBuild = true ; - + installPhase = '' runHook preInstall - + mkdir -p $out/lib/python3.11/site-packages cp -r $src/pgtrigger $out/lib/python3.11/site-packages/ - + runHook postInstall '' ; } diff --git a/python3.11-django-sass-processor.nix b/python3.11-django-sass-processor.nix index 8caaba3..52134f4 100644 --- a/python3.11-django-sass-processor.nix +++ b/python3.11-django-sass-processor.nix @@ -8,20 +8,24 @@ with stdenv ; mkDerivation { pname = "python-django-sass-processor" ; version = "2024-05-29-0d8cb67" ; - + src = fetchFromGitHub { owner = "jrief" ; repo = "django-sass-processor" ; rev = "0d8cb672aab9ecc45e8492794530ca847ce24547" ; hash = "sha256-Z3UzzkHlMNiyhj7YPRDgAX0437BywPG/waNSPoNiKLo=" ; } ; - + + dontPatch = true ; + dontConfigure = true ; + dontBuild = true ; + installPhase = '' runHook preInstall - + mkdir -p $out/lib/python3.11/site-packages cp -r $src/sass_processor $out/lib/python3.11/site-packages/ - + runHook postInstall '' ; }